How do solar panels remove dust?

Here, an autonomous dust removal system for solar panels, powered by a wind-driven rotary electret generator is proposed. The generator applies a high voltage between one solar panel's output electrode and an upper mesh electrode to generate a strong electrostatic field.

What is solar dust removal technology?

The technology employs a non-uniform traveling field to generate charge polarization and induce electrophoretic/dielectrophoretic forces, enabling automatic dust removal from the surface of solar panels , , , , .

Can dust be removed from solar panels using electrostatic induction?

Here, we present a waterless approach for dust removal from solar panels using electrostatic induction. We find that dust particles, despite primarily consisting of insulating silica, can be electrostatically repelled from electrodes due to charge induction assisted by adsorbed moisture.

What is an autonomous dust removal system powered by wind energy?

In summary, an autonomous dust removal system powered by wind energy has been developed. The ADRS comprises a REG, a VMC, and DRUs. The REG with VMC harvests wind energy to provide a high DC voltage between an upper mesh electrode and one of the output electrodes of the solar panel to generate a strong electrostatic field.
